A rectangle has a perimeter of 110 inches. The rectangle' s length is five more than twice the width.

Answer:

Length is 38[tex]\frac{1}{3}[/tex] inches

Width is 16[tex]\frac{2}{3}[/tex] inches

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the width be x inches

The length will be 2x + 5 inches

The perimeter is 110 inches

Perimeter is given by (2 × length) + (2 × width)

2(2x + 5) + 2x = 110 inches

4x + 10 + 2x = 110 inches

6x = 100 inches

x (width) = 100/6 = 16[tex]\frac{2}{3}[/tex] inches

Length = 2(100/6) + 5 = 38[tex]\frac{1}{3}[/tex] inches.
